"Dosed: The Medication Generation Grows Up" by Kaitlin Bell Barnett is a 2012 hardcover book published by Beacon Press. The book delves into the psychology and medical aspects of psychiatry, psychopharmacology, and mental health. Author Kaitlin Bell Barnett explores the topic of psychopathology, focusing on the effects of medication on a generation of individuals struggling with mental health issues. With 256 pages, the book offers in-depth insights into the world of pharmacology and its impact on the individuals within the medication generation.
